Frog: A Paramedic’s Wild Ride on the Edge of Life and Death

‘A riveting ride along the knife edge of life and death from a frontline worker in one of our most crucial professions.’ Fiona Kelly McGregor, author of *Iris*

‘Frog’, a term of endearment for intensive care paramedics, derives from the notion that everything they touch croaks. Sally Gould delivers a gripping and heartfelt memoir that dives into the unpredictable, often absurd, and sometimes…

About The Author

Sally Gould

Sally Gould has been a paramedic for fourteen years and counting, and still finds joy in her self-proclaimed dream job. The professional and personal growth she experienced on the frontline, and the journals she kept during her early years in the field, were the inspiration for her memoir Frog. Her draft manuscript won the narrative non-fiction category in the 2023 ASA/CA Award Mentorship Program. When she’s not in uniform, Sally can be found tutoring paramedic students or immersed in her writing. She spends the rest of her days off nurturing herself through running, bushwalking, baking, attending theatre, and spending time with family and friends. Sally lives in Sydney with her husband and their two children.
